Lawn care in Sparta, MO, like in any other place, is a year-round task that requires dedication, patience, and a good understanding of the local climate and soil type. The region experiences a humid subtropical climate, which means the lawn care practices may be slightly different compared to those in cooler or drier climates.

Firstly, mowing is a crucial part of lawn care in Sparta. Regular mowing helps maintain a healthy lawn, and it's best done when the grass is dry. The rule of thumb is to not cut more than one-third of the grass blade at a time, as this could lead to a weakened lawn. Regular mowing is particularly important in the summer months when the grass grows faster.

Fertilizing is another significant aspect of lawn care. In Sparta, the most beneficial time to fertilize is in the early Spring and late Fall. This is when your grass is growing rapidly and can absorb the nutrients effectively. In terms of soil type, Sparta, especially neighborhoods like Spring Valley and Fairview, typically has clay or loamy soil, which holds nutrients and moisture well but may need aerating and dethatching from time to time to prevent compaction and improve water infiltration.

Seeding, on the other hand, is best done in the early fall when the temperatures are cooler, and there's plenty of moisture in the soil. This gives the grass seeds ample time to germinate and establish themselves before the winter sets in. Watering is vital too, especially during the drier summer months. Remember to water deeply but less frequently to encourage the growth of deep roots. However, always be mindful of any water restrictions in your area.
